synopsis
Osho News account is a partial translation of "a sizeable article by Shyam Lal Soni, a childhood friend of Osho", in which Osho declares to his companions that religion and philosophy shall be his calling. They are surprised, as it is a big change. They are sitting by the local river, Shakkar Nadi, which flows into the Narmada about 20 km north of their location, about 150 km downstream from Jabalpur. The occasion is Kartik Purnima, the full moon of November, the largest and brightest full moon (Supermoon) of the 20th century.
